Key Cutting
Mazda keys have chip inside them that communicates with your car when the key is inserted into the ignition barrel. This helps to prevent car theft by ensuring that the correct key is used to start the vehicle. The key chip contains an unique code that must match the one of your engine control unit (ECU). If the code does not match it, the ECU will prevent the engine from turning.
If you're looking for a new key for your car your locksmith needs to know what kind of chip is in your current mazda cx-5 key fob replacement cost key, and whether it is an integrated chip within the key fob or it has a separate chip inside the key head that fits into the ignition lock. This will enable the locksmith to gather the required supplies and determine whether programming is needed for the replacement key.
If your Mazda isn't equipped with chip inside the key head, it's probably an edge style key. Locksmiths can make the replacement key for this Mazda model by using a key-cutting machine on site to copy the key contours. Alternately, you can take your old key to a Home Depot to have it cut into a standard metal key.
Transponder Key Programming
Transponder keys are fitted with an electronic microchip. This is a measure of security that assists in preventing car theft. When the key is fitted into the ignition lock cylinder and turned into the ON position the key sends a flash of radio frequency energy to the antenna ring of the vehicle. The chip inside the key will then transmit an unique identification code to the vehicle's receiver, that then tells the car's starter to start.
It is vital to follow the proper procedure when programming a transponder key. A professional can make sure that the process is done correctly. There is a risk of damage to the transponder chip when wrong programming steps are taken. This can cause the key to stop functioning and could even necessitate that a transponder is replaced.
There are many different ways to program a transponder key and the method you choose to use will depend on the kind of vehicle. Some are simpler than others, and a knowledgeable locksmith will know which to use for each vehicle. Repair of the ignition Cylinder
The ignition cylinder is the component that you insert your key into to start your car. It is susceptible to wear and tear or even break because of the excessive jiggling of the key. A damaged cylinder could stop you from starting your vehicle, and in extreme cases it could make it difficult to insert or remove the keys. This is a major safety risk and you must have it replaced as soon as possible.
The process of replacing it isn't very difficult, but it can be messy and requires the dismantling of the steering column. To complete this task, you'll be required to disconnect the battery and Mazda Cx-5 Key Fob Replacement Cost then remove the screws and bolts from the steering column housing and switch assembly. A screwdriver is used to depress the small anti-rotation switch and then the cylinder will be removed from its case. The new cylinder will then be installed in reverse order of removal, with the tumblers that were previously removed and set aside for use in programming.

Key Fob Replacement
Many cars today use key fobs. It is an electronic remote that allows you to unlock your car's doors and turn on the engine. These devices, unlike older keys made of metal, are wirelessly programmed so that they only function with a single vehicle. This makes them costly to replace, and you'll need an expert to reprogram them if you lose them.
Depending on the kind of fob you have you may be able to purchase a brand new battery for it at an hardware store or a big-box retailer. The majority of key fobs have the battery type listed on their cases so it's easy to recognize. But, you'll need take the fob off to get to it Some cases are difficult to open without damaging the plastic.
If you're on a budget it's tempting to search for a bargain replacement fob on the internet or at an auto parts store. But experts warn that these aren't as reliable or safe. Some could be fake. "If you buy a secondhand or recycled fob, there's no guarantee that it'll work on your vehicle," says CR's Yu.
If you're stranded without a working key fob check your insurance policy, warranty on your vehicle, policy, or auto club membership to see whether they will cover the cost of replacing it. Also, be sure to keep your old key fob in a good condition so it can still open your doors if you need to.
